Project Planning
Review Project Specifications: Study the tender requirements and technical documents.
Develop a Project Timeline: Define key milestones, including design, procurement, assembly,
and commissioning.
Budget Allocation: Ensure the project budget aligns with the tender specifications.
Detailed Engineering: Create detailed drawings, wiring schematics, and BOM (Bill of Materials).
Approval Process: Submit the designs to the client or consultant for review and approval.
3. Procurement
Material Selection: Source materials and components as per the approved design and project
specifications.
Vendor Coordination: Work with trusted suppliers to ensure timely delivery of quality
components.
Component Assembly: Mount and wire components inside the panel according to the wiring
diagrams.
Internal Testing: Perform pre-testing to check functionality and compliance with standards.
6. Installation
Site Preparation: Prepare the installation site, including civil works and foundations.
Panel Installation: Transport the power panel to the site and install it in its designated location.
Cabling and Connections: Connect incoming and outgoing cables to the panel.
System Integration: Integrate the power panel with other electrical systems.
Load Testing: Test the panel under load conditions to verify performance.
Final Commissioning: Conduct final testing in the presence of the client or consultant.
Prepare Documentation: Submit as-built drawings, test reports, and operation manuals.
9. Post-Commissioning Support
Warranty and Support: Provide warranty service and address any issues during the initial
operation phase.
